2 on 2 - stay with the opponent, move with him and don't hand over

Setup

Four players (blue A and B defenders/ red C and D attackers) are positioned on the field according to the diagram. The ball is with player D.

Procedure

When completing the drill: The exercise starts with a pass from player C to player D, who immediately starts to dribble forward. Simultaneously player B breaks away from his defensive position and attacks player D. A moves into the defensive position of B. Directly after his pass to D, C overlaps D. D dribbles diagonally to the left in a central position. B stays with player D. A intersects behind B and orientates himself towards player C. As soon as the player is in the penalty area, the drill is over.

Tip

1 full-court goal(s), - In contrast to the exercise \'2 on 2 - engage with handover\' the defenders participate here in the attackers\' changing of positions, as this drill takes place in a goal scoring area and \'handing over\' can lead to a temporary shooting opportunity for the ball carrying attacker.\n- This exercise is a dry run. No tackling takes place. The primary function of the exercise is the learning of paths in soccer.\n- The exercise should be repeatedly trained as many times as possible (automation of movement sequences).\n- A precise and powerful passing game should be paid attention to. - The start signal for the counter reaction is when the passer of the ball moves to pass. \n- The lateral distance between the players at the starting position should consist of approximately 7-12m. The pair of players stand opposite each other with a distance of 15m between them.
